Defining Your Unique Voice

Your brand’s voice is the personality that shines through in every content you create. It’s how you communicate your message, the words you choose, and the overall tone you convey. Think of it as the way your brand would speak if it were a person.

Key Considerations:

Personality Traits:

  •  Is your brand playful and quirky?

  •  Authoritative and professional?

  •  Inspirational and Aspirational?

⤷ Pinpoint the specific traits that best represent your brand.

Tone:

  •  Is your tone casual and conversational?

  •  Formal and academic?

  •  Witty and humorous?

⤷ The tone you adopt should align with your brand’s personality and resonate with your target audience.

Language: The words you use, the sentence structure, and the overall style of your writing all contribute to your brand’s unique voice. Avoid generic, cookie-cutter language and develop a signature style.

Consistency: Maintain a consistent voice across all your content, from social media posts to website copy to email newsletters. This helps reinforce your brand’s identity and builds trust with your audience.

Elevating Your Content with Tone

While your brand’s voice is the “what” behind your content, your tone is the “how.” It’s the way you deliver your message, and it can have a significant impact on how your audience perceives and engages with your content.

Key Considerations:

  •  Tailor your tone to resonate with your target audience. A formal, academic tone may work well for a B2B audience, while a more casual, conversational tone might be more effective for a consumer-facing brand.

  •  Use your tone to evoke specific emotions in your audience, whether it’s inspiration, humour, or empathy. This can help you build a deeper, more meaningful connection with your readers.

  •  Your tone should be flexible enough to adapt to different content formats and channels. A lighthearted, playful tone might work well on social media, while a more serious, informative tone might be more appropriate for a thought leadership article.

Putting it All Together

Defining your brand’s voice and tone is an ongoing process, but the payoff is well worth the effort. By crafting a unique, authentic voice and tailoring your tone to your audience, you can elevate your content and stand out in a crowded marketplace.

Key Takeaways:

  •  Your brand’s voice is the personality that shines through in your content.

  •  The tone is the “how” behind your message and it can significantly impact audience engagement.

  •  Consistency is key – maintain a cohesive voice and tone across all your content.

  •  Tailor your tone to resonate with your target audience and evoke specific emotions.

  •  Continuously refine and adapt your voice and tone to stay relevant and engaging.
